Ductility - an overview | ScienceDirect Topics

Ductility is the ability of a material to sustain a large permanent deformation under a tensile load up to the point of fracture, or the relative ability of a material to be stretched plastically at room temperature without fracturing. Ductility can be measured by the amount of permanent deformation indicated by the stress-strain curve.

Cold Work & Annealing Process - Google Search

A material loses ductility when it is cold worked or moreover, cold rolled. If one wishes to partially or fully restore a cold worked material to its original properties, one can anneal the material. Annealing is performed by heating a material; in this instance, the material is a metal.

mechanical engineering - What is a "mill-hardened ...

Mill hardening would refer to work hardening, where cold-rolling the material distorts the grain structure and causes dislocation pile-up and entanglements, which reduce the material's ductility and thereby increase its yield strength.

Difference Between Ductility and Malleability

Similarities and differences between ductility and brittleness are explained here. Ductility is the measure of the ability of a material to deform plastically under external tensile loading; while, malleability is the measure of the ability of a material to deform plastically under external compressive loading.

Learn About Quenching & Tempering - Clifton Steel

The slower the cooling process, the more austenitic grain structure will remain, providing a soft material with good ductility but lower strength. A very fast cool produces a total martensite grain structure, making a product high in strength but not ductile. Bending Basics: The fundamentals of heavy bending

A plate's grain direction comes from the mill's rolling process, which stretches the metallurgical structure and inclusions of the material. The grains run parallel to the rolling direction. Forming with the grain requires less bending force because the material's ductility is readily stretched.
